sorry didnt updated this thread in long time.

for me mcb lite process in lahore.

1. registered online at their website with just mobile number and email
2. got call 3 days later from mcb sir your card is in post. took nic, address, numbers, etc.
3. 5 or 6 days later got card received at home.
4. called mcb call center they told ok your details are confirmed. plz visit nearest branch (akbar chowk lahore)
5. visited branch. deposited 1200rs via deposit slip. account number was my mobile number.
6. instantly got text confirmation rs1200 deposited.
7. called call center. they said plz let us speak to bank operations manager. he confirmed details. took my nic enterd something on computer and that was it.

IMPORTANT NOTE: dont leave branch without talking to call center and tell them to speak to branch operations manager to activate your card.

8. 2 hours later used mcb lite account for first purchase (ufone credit)

hope it helps you out. will be ordering thru aliexpress and google play. will report how it goes.

as for ubl wiz, whoever uses it - my info (from 4 years before when i made it) was that u get charged for each transaction online. plz verify it before you buy it.
